**Who we’re looking for:**
Rogers is seeking a Platform System Analyst to focus on monitoring and supporting our critical infrastructure 24X7 which includes Windows, Linux virtual machines, Netapp Storage, Hp and Cisco blades.
**What you’ll do:**
+ Accountable for 24/7/365 monitoring and service restoration of the core Data Centre infrastructure.
+ Working on a ‘4 on 4 off’ rotation schedule that can include weekends evening and overnight shifts.
+ Reviewing the work queue and sharing the workload for incoming service requests, escalations and incidents.
+ Analyzing and interpreting incoming alert situations and mitigating risk to services.
+ Participating in postmortems when required.
+ Supporting front-line staff through escalations received.
+ Collaborating with other technical support teams to ensure swift resolution of incidents and to follow up to get resolution on outstanding items.
+ Responsible for managing and executing change controls against server hardware and operating environments (i.e., updates, hardware replacements, builds/new infrastructure, and patching) often after business hours.
+ Creating and maintaining technical documentation and procedures for the team.
+ Contributing to process development within the team to support the Rogers vision of delivering an Exceptional Customer Experience.
+ Making recommendations to improve department processes and introduce technologies or automation that will enhance efficiency.
**What you bring:**
+ 4 - 5 years of hands-on experience in a support role managing server environments.
+ A solid understanding of VMware, VCentre, Linux, Windows, Cisco /HP Blade servers, and storage technologies including Nutanix.
+ Hands-on experience with various monitoring platforms (Vsure,Netcool,HP Openview, OpenNMS, SCOM, Splunk experience would be an asset etc.)
+ Post-secondary or technical diploma/degree/certification.
+ Current technology certifications in any of the supported solutions is an asset.
+ Experience in a multi-service, multi-vendor environment.
+ In-depth knowledge of internet protocols and internet-related services including email, DNS, DHCP, SNMP as well as other related protocols.
+ Solid understanding of Service Management principles and experience utilizing ServiceNow and CMDB.
+ Excellent analytical and troubleshooting skills, using a structured and methodical approach to solving problems.
+ A great communicator, clear and concise (both in written and verbal).
+ Previous experience working rotational 24/7/365 shift work.
+ A positive, “can-do” attitude and customer-focused approach toward issues
+ Desire to work in a collaborative team environment where you can share ideas and make a difference!
